From 21ae45b8bea4c5000759993fb6d0919fcbfb7565 Mon Sep 17 00:00:00 2001 From: Mike Reeves Date: Mon, 24 Sep 2018 22:22:00 -0400 Subject: [PATCH] Steno Module - Add User to Config and add techpreview tag --- salt/pcap/files/config | 2 +- salt/pcap/init.sls | 2 +- so-setup-network.sh | 4 +--- 3 files changed, 3 insertions(+), 5 deletions(-) diff --git a/salt/pcap/files/config b/salt/pcap/files/config index 57dc3bc1a..c6ff08206 100644 --- a/salt/pcap/files/config +++ b/salt/pcap/files/config @@ -11,6 +11,6 @@ , "Interface": "{{ interface }}" , "Port": 1234 , "Host": "127.0.0.1" - , "Flags": ["-v"] + , "Flags": ["-v", "--uid=stenographer", "--gid=stenographer"] , "CertPath": "/etc/stenographer/certs" } diff --git a/salt/pcap/init.sls b/salt/pcap/init.sls index 69e6a5ff3..3d0321d0e 100644 --- a/salt/pcap/init.sls +++ b/salt/pcap/init.sls @@ -66,7 +66,7 @@ pcapindexdir: so-steno: docker_container.running: - - image: toosmooth/so-steno:test2 + - image: toosmooth/so-steno:techpreview - network_mode: host - privileged: True - port_bindings: diff --git a/so-setup-network.sh b/so-setup-network.sh index 8b04fb597..12c8e25b3 100644 --- a/so-setup-network.sh +++ b/so-setup-network.sh @@ -188,9 +188,7 @@ create_bond() { do echo $line >> /etc/network/interfaces done - - cp $TMP/interfaces /etc/network/interfaces - + IFS=$'\n' for line in $MINT do